- Paint the large clay pot with a smiling scarecrow face, adding rosy cheeks and a stitched nose for charm. 
- Thread jute rope through the mini pots, knotting between each to create dangling bells. 
- Attach the rope inside the large pot so the smaller pots hang below. 
- Glue raffia strands around the rim of the pot to mimic hair, letting them peek from under the hat. 
- Decorate the straw hat with faux leaves and berries, then glue it firmly onto the top of the pot. 
- Hang the finished scarecrow from a tree branch or porch hook where it can sway lightly in the wind.
